How do I reformat my hard drive with Windows XP?
Personal information is constantly being stored on your computer. To remove this information you can reformat the hard drive with Windows XP. You may need to reformat your hard drive to eliminate this information, remove a virus, or repair problems with the computer.These steps will help you on how to reformat the hard drive with Windows XP. Not all information will be removed if you reformat the hard drive. To see what how to completely erase and reformat the hard drive you can follow the instructions at the bottom.
How to Reformat Your Hard Drive with Windows XP
- Backup all important data
- Disconnect network and Internet connections
- Jot down network and computer configurations
- Make a bootable disk
- Insert the Windows XP CD
- After inserting the Windows XP CD reboot the computer. You can choose to do this from the CD or on the Start Menu.
- The computer should boot from the CD. If this does not happen and you are at a login screen consult your manufacturer.
- Choose to boot from the CD if this does not happen automatically.
- The Windows setup screen should appear
- In the next menu choose to setup or repair Windows.
- Read the License Agreement
- If the system detects an existing installation of Windows, choose to skip the repair
- The process will then ask you where you would like to install Windows. Choose the currently selected partition unless you need to install it on a different partition.
- Format the drive with the NTFS file system
- Create an administrator login
- The computer should eject the CD and restart when the reinstallation is finished. If not manually eject the CD
- Reconnect the network or any other connections that were disconnected.
